I use Amazon Prime for movies and TV if I want some. It’s like netflix, 7.99, except it also gives you some pretty decent deals on non-movie stuff you might buy on Amazon (computer monitors etc ... that kind of non-movie stuff), you automatically get free 2 day shipping on almost anything.
I can’t vouch for this because I haven’t used netflix for years ... but one difference at Amazon is that a ton of movies and series are free (if you have the 7.99 Amazon Prime), and then some you pay for. At first this may seem bad, however, given that the streaming market has gotten to saturation point, I believe that all it does is give you the option, if you want, to watch higher quality moves and series earlier ... so if you want to pay for a really popular/recent series ... you can.
But there is still plenty of content without paying extra.

Remember ‘way back when’ Congress passed the law etc that the bank would have to process your pay check immediately (or sooner) and the people ‘roared with approval’ that those nasty banks would finally get theirs.
Then, when they had to move paper swiftly to process YOUR pay check they were able to process checks you wrote.
So, the good old days of mailing a check on Tues have the (whoever) receive it on Thurs and not be processed till Monday were gone....quick as they get it, it is posted and out of your account....
SO be very careful for what you wish for, there is also a flip side that will pretty much bite you in the arse.

Hulu ownership:
NBCUniversal Television Group (32%)
Fox Broadcasting Company (31%)
Disney-ABC Television Group (27%)
Providence Equity Partners (10%)
